Where each one falls short
Documented limitations, not opinions. Every one is a constraint you would hit in normal use.
TrueNAS
- Requires self-hosting on x86 hardware, no managed cloud offering; organisations must provision, configure, and maintain their own infrastructure
- ZFS filesystem entails high memory requirements (1 GB RAM per 1 TB of storage recommended), increasing costs for large deployments
- Limited ARM/embedded support; Community Edition is primarily x86-64, reducing deployment options for edge installations
- Clustering and replication setup requires operational expertise; misconfiguration can lead to data loss
- Enterprise support and SLA guarantees require paid subscriptions; Community Edition relies on peer-based forums
Vagrant
- Vagrant 2.4.3 and later is licensed under the Business Source License 1.1 with IBM Corporation as licensor, not an OSI open source licence
- The Additional Use Grant forbids offering Vagrant to third parties on a hosted or embedded basis in a paid product that competes with IBM's paid versions of Vagrant
- Each version converts to the MPL 2.0 Change License only four years after that version is first published
- Uses that fall outside the Additional Use Grant require a separately negotiated licence from the licensor

Answered from the vendors’ own pages
TrueNAS: What is the cost of TrueNAS Community Edition?
TrueNAS Community Edition is free and open-source. There are no licensing fees, but organisations must purchase and maintain their own x86 hardware. Enterprise Edition requires paid support contracts for production environments.
SourceTrueNAS: Can I replicate TrueNAS data between sites?
Yes. TrueNAS supports snapshot-based replication over network links, enabling disaster recovery and business continuity. Replication can occur between Community Edition systems or between Enterprise Appliances.
SourceTrueNAS: What storage protocols does TrueNAS support?
TrueNAS simultaneously supports NFS (network file system), SMB (Windows file sharing), iSCSI (block storage), and S3-compatible object storage, all from the same storage pool.
